Output 267fae20fc62b84d6f8c33ef27b2117a729fc27a608f8a74954ced8399aa8276:0

value
766152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c08e1517e8304119aa2212df92b8d8a7f3a85765 OP_EQUAL
address
3KF9sS5LVvz7R4mpBzf4vn3EXmnLNGhiGX
transaction
267fae20fc62b84d6f8c33ef27b2117a729fc27a608f8a74954ced8399aa8276
spent
false